
This from Don Wilson of Christ's Church of the Valley
"The problem with facilities is convincing people that they are the church on Monday through Saturday and not just on Sunday. IOW, ministry can and must happen anywhere, not just on church property.
Most new churches build their building too soon and too small.
Two essentials: "critical mass" and "momentum." Lead by example.
Big vision attracts people with big vision.
Every time we go through building programs, we suffer big Satanic attacks. Don't plan too far out. No 5-year (or longer) plans. Need to work on core values. Difference between successful churches and successful corporations -- successful churches tend to be personality driven and successful corporations tends to be core values driven. We need to determine our core values! Do more with less. CCV plans to cut out 1/3 of their ministries in the next year! You are your greatest leadership challenge. Your leadership style has to change at every level. Old Proverb: "An army of sheep led by a lion will always defeat an army of lions led by a sheep." Sacrifice was a real focus today, and Don Wilson asked, how do you get people who don't tithe to understand the concept of sacrifice? 90% of the things we pray about in our churches are things that Jesus never prayed about. Jesus prayed about kingdom issues. CCV's vision is to WIN, TRAIN, and SEND, and their priority is on the winning part. Instead of the old "here's the church, here's the steeple, open the doors and here are the people," it should be "here's the church, here's the steeple, open the doors and release all the people."
